{"id":2900,"date":"2022-08-23T09:23:54","date_gmt":"2022-08-23T00:23:54","guid":{"rendered":"https:\/\/p-corporate-blog-cms.mmmcorp.co.jp\/?p=2900"},"modified":"2022-08-23T09:23:54","modified_gmt":"2022-08-23T00:23:54","slug":"well-architected-serverless-lens","status":"publish","type":"post","link":"https:\/\/p-corporate-blog-cms.mmmcorp.co.jp\/blog\/2022\/08\/23\/well-architected-serverless-lens\/","title":{"rendered":"AWS Well-Architected Tool \u306eLens\u3092\u6d3b\u7528\u3057\u3066\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u3092\u30ec\u30d3\u30e5\u30fc\u3057\u3088\u3046"},"content":{"rendered":"
\u3053\u3093\u306b\u3061\u306f\u3002\u571f\u5c45\u3067\u3059\u3002 \u4eca\u56de\u306f\u3001\u300cAWS Well-Architected Tool\u300d\u306e\u300c\u30ec\u30f3\u30ba\u300d\u3068\u3044\u3046\u7279\u5b9a\u306e\u9818\u57df\u306b\u7279\u5316\u3057\u305f\u8ffd\u52a0\u306e\u30ec\u30d3\u30e5\u30fc\u3092\u884c\u3046\u305f\u3081\u306e\u6a5f\u80fd\u306b\u3064\u3044\u3066\u3054\u7d39\u4ecb\u3044\u305f\u3057\u307e\u3059\u3002<\/p>\n \u30ec\u30f3\u30ba\u3068\u306f\u3001AWS Well-Architected \u306b\u304a\u3051\u308b\u4e00\u9023\u306e\u8cea\u554f\u306e\u307e\u3068\u307e\u308a\u3092\u8868\u3057\u307e\u3059\u3002 \u30ec\u30d3\u30e5\u30fc\u3092\u958b\u59cb\u3059\u308b\u969b\u306bAWS Well-Architected Tool\u3067\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u3092\u5b9a\u7fa9\u3059\u308b\u3068\u3001\u30c7\u30d5\u30a9\u30eb\u30c8\u306758\u500b\u306e\u57fa\u790e\u7684\u306a\u8cea\u554f\u3092\u6301\u3064\u300cAWS-Well-Architected Framework\u300d\u306e\u30ec\u30f3\u30ba\u304c\u5fc5\u9808\u3067\u9078\u629e\u3055\u308c\u307e\u3059\u3002<\/p>\n \u305d\u308c\u306b\u52a0\u3048\u3001\u7279\u5b9a\u306e\u9818\u57df\u306b\u7279\u5316\u3057\u305f\u8ffd\u52a0\u306e\u8cea\u554f\u3092\u6301\u3064\u591a\u5f69\u306a\u30ec\u30f3\u30ba\u3092\u9078\u629e\u3059\u308b\u3053\u3068\u304c\u3067\u304d\u307e\u3059\u3002<\/p>\n \u4eca\u56de\u306f\u3053\u306e\u5185\u306e\u300c\u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u3000\u30ec\u30f3\u30ba\u300d\u306e\u8cea\u554f\u306b\u3064\u3044\u3066\u3001\u3069\u306e\u3088\u3046\u306a\u7279\u5fb4\u304c\u3042\u308b\u306e\u304b\u3092\u307f\u3066\u3044\u304d\u305f\u3044\u3068\u601d\u3044\u307e\u3059\u3002<\/p>\n \u203b\u30ec\u30f3\u30ba\u306b\u3064\u3044\u3066\u306f\u4ee5\u4e0b\u306eAWS Well-Architected Tool\u306e\u516c\u5f0f\u30c9\u30ad\u30e5\u30e1\u30f3\u30c8\u306b\u3064\u3044\u3066\u3082\u662f\u975e\u3054\u53c2\u7167\u304f\u3060\u3055\u3044\u3002 AWS_Well-Architected_Lenses<\/a><\/p>\n \u307e\u305a\u8cea\u554f\u306e\u7dcf\u6570\u3067\u3059\u304c\u3001\u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u306e\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u306b\u7279\u5316\u3057\u305f\u30d4\u30f3\u30dd\u30a4\u30f3\u30c8\u306e\u8cea\u554f\u3068\u306a\u3063\u3066\u304a\u308a\u3001\u300cAWS-Well-Architected Framework \u30ec\u30f3\u30ba\u300d\u306e58\u500b\u3068\u6bd4\u8f03\u3059\u308b\u3068\u305d\u306e\u6570\u306f9\u500b\u3001\u3068\u5c11\u306a\u3081\u306b\u306a\u3063\u3066\u3044\u307e\u3059\u3002<\/p>\n 5\u3064\u306e\u67f1\u3054\u3068\u306b\u8cea\u554f\u304c\u7528\u610f\u3055\u308c\u3066\u3044\u308b\u306e\u306f\u540c\u3058\u3067\u3059\u3002\uff08\u203b\u6301\u7d9a\u53ef\u80fd\u6027\u306e\u307f\u3001\u8cea\u554f\u7121\u3057\uff09<\/p>\n \u4ee5\u4e0b\u3001\u305d\u308c\u305e\u308c\u306e\u67f1\u3054\u3068\u306b\u30d4\u30c3\u30af\u30a2\u30c3\u30d7\u3057\u3066\u898b\u3066\u3044\u304d\u307e\u3059\u3002<\/p>\n \u300c\u904b\u7528\u4e0a\u306e\u512a\u79c0\u6027\u300d\u306e\u67f1\u306f\u3001\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u306e\u5168\u3066\u306e\u5c40\u9762\u306b\u304b\u304b\u308f\u3063\u3066\u304f\u308b\u305f\u3081\u6700\u3082\u512a\u5148\u3057\u305f\u3044\u3068\u8003\u3048\u3089\u308c\u308b\u304a\u5ba2\u69d8\u304c\u591a\u3044\u5370\u8c61\u3067\u3059\u3002<\/p>\n AWS Well-Architected Framework\u3000\u904b\u7528\u4e0a\u306e\u512a\u79c0\u6027<\/a> \u306b\u304a\u3051\u308b\uff14\u3064\u306e\u30d9\u30b9\u30c8\u30d7\u30e9\u30af\u30c6\u30a3\u30b9(\u7d44\u7e54\u3001\u6e96\u5099\u3001\u904b\u7528\u3001\u9032\u5316)\u306e\u5177\u4f53\u7684\u306a\u5b9f\u8df5\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n \u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u306e\u72b6\u614b\u3092\u3069\u306e\u3088\u3046\u306b\u8a55\u4fa1\u3057\u307e\u3059\u304b? \u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u306e\u30e9\u30a4\u30d5\u30b5\u30a4\u30af\u30eb\u7ba1\u7406\u306b\u3064\u3044\u3066\u6559\u3048\u3066\u4e0b\u3055\u3044 \u300c\u904b\u7528\u4e0a\u306e\u512a\u79c0\u6027\u300d\u306e\u67f1\u3068\u4e26\u3073\u3001\u591a\u304f\u306e\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u3067\u6700\u3082\u512a\u5148\u5ea6\u304c\u9ad8\u304f\u6349\u3048\u3089\u308c\u308b\u300c\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u300d\u306e\u67f1\u306f\u3001\u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u306e\u30ec\u30f3\u30ba\u306b\u304a\u3044\u3066\u6700\u3082\u8cea\u554f\u6570\u304c\u591a\u3044\u67f1\u3068\u306a\u3063\u3066\u3044\u307e\u3059\u3002 \u30b5\u30fc\u30d0\u30fc\u30ec\u30b9 API \u3078\u306e\u30a2\u30af\u30bb\u30b9\u3092\u3069\u306e\u3088\u3046\u306b\u30b3\u30f3\u30c8\u30ed\u30fc\u30eb\u3057\u307e\u3059\u304b? \u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u306e\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u5883\u754c\u3092\u3069\u306e\u3088\u3046\u306b\u7ba1\u7406\u3057\u3066\u3044\u307e\u3059\u304b? \u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u306b\u3069\u306e\u3088\u3046\u306b\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u3092\u5b9f\u88c5\u3057\u307e\u3059\u304b? AWS Well-Architected Framework\u3000\u4fe1\u983c\u6027<\/a> \u306b\u304a\u3051\u308b6\u3064\u306e\u30d9\u30b9\u30c8\u30d7\u30e9\u30af\u30c6\u30a3\u30b9(\u57fa\u76e4\u3001\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u30a2\u30fc\u30ad\u30c6\u30af\u30c1\u30e3\u3001\u5909\u66f4\u7ba1\u7406\u3001\u969c\u5bb3\u306e\u7ba1\u7406)\u306e\u5177\u4f53\u7684\u306a\u5b9f\u8df5\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n \u30a4\u30f3\u30d0\u30a6\u30f3\u30c9\u30ea\u30af\u30a8\u30b9\u30c8\u7387\u306f\u3069\u306e\u3088\u3046\u306b\u8abf\u6574\u3057\u3066\u3044\u307e\u3059\u304b? \u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u306b\u306f\u56de\u5fa9\u529b\u3092\u3069\u306e\u3088\u3046\u306b\u7d44\u307f\u8fbc\u3093\u3067\u3044\u307e\u3059\u304b?
\n\u4ee5\u524d\u3001DWS\u306eWell Architected \u30ec\u30d3\u30e5\u30fc<\/a>\u306e\u8a18\u4e8b\u3067DWS\u304c\u3069\u306e\u3088\u3046\u306bAWS Well-Architected\u30ec\u30d3\u30e5\u30fc\u3092\u5b9f\u65bd\u3057\u3066\u3044\u308b\u304b\u3092\u304a\u4f1d\u3048\u3057\u307e\u3057\u305f\u3002
\n\u203bAWS Well-Architected\u3063\u3066\uff1f\u3068\u3044\u3046\u65b9\u306f\u3053\u3061\u3089\u306e\u8a18\u4e8b\u3082\u662f\u975e\u3054\u89a7\u304f\u3060\u3055\u3044\u3002\u300eAWS Well-Architected \u30d5\u30ec\u30fc\u30e0\u30ef\u30fc\u30af \u52c9\u5f37\u4f1a\u300f\u306e\u30b9\u30b9\u30e1<\/a><\/p>\n\u30ec\u30f3\u30ba\u3068\u306f<\/h2>\n
\n\u8cea\u554f\u306f\uff16\u3064\u306e\u67f1\uff08\u904b\u7528\u4e0a\u306e\u512a\u79c0\u6027\u3001\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u3001\u4fe1\u983c\u6027\u3001\u30d1\u30d5\u30a9\u30fc\u30de\u30f3\u30b9\u52b9\u7387\u3001\u30b3\u30b9\u30c8\u6700\u9069\u5316\u3001\u6301\u7d9a\u53ef\u80fd\u6027\uff09\u306b\u5206\u985e\u3055\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n\n
\nLenses<\/a><\/p>\n\u30b5\u30fc\u30d0\u30fc\u30ec\u30b9\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u3000\u30ec\u30f3\u30ba \u306e\u7279\u5fb4<\/h2>\n
OPS(\u904b\u7528\u4e0a\u306e\u512a\u79c0\u6027\u306e\u67f1)<\/h3>\n
\n
\n\u5404\u30de\u30cd\u30fc\u30b8\u30c9\u30b5\u30fc\u30d3\u30b9\u306e\u30e1\u30c8\u30ea\u30af\u30b9\u306e\u7406\u89e3\u3001\u5206\u6563\u30c8\u30ec\u30fc\u30b9\u306e\u5b9f\u88c5\u3001\u69cb\u9020\u7684\u306a\u30ed\u30b0\u60c5\u5831\u306e\u51fa\u529b\u306a\u3069\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n<\/li>\n
\nIaC\u3001\u69cb\u6210\u7ba1\u7406\u3001CI\/CD(\u30e6\u30cb\u30c3\u30c8\u30c6\u30b9\u30c8\u30fb\u7d71\u5408\u30c6\u30b9\u30c8\u30fb\u30a8\u30f3\u30c9\u30c4\u30fc\u30a8\u30f3\u30c9\u30c6\u30b9\u30c8\u3092\u542b\u3080)\u306e\u4f7f\u7528\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n<\/li>\n<\/ul>\nSEC(\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u306e\u67f1)<\/h3>\n
\nAWS Well-Architected Framework\u3000\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3<\/a> \u306b\u304a\u3051\u308b6\u3064\u306e\u30d9\u30b9\u30c8\u30d7\u30e9\u30af\u30c6\u30a3\u30b9(\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u3001Identity and Access Management\u3001\u691c\u51fa\u3001\u30a4\u30f3\u30d5\u30e9\u30b9\u30c8\u30e9\u30af\u30c1\u30e3\u4fdd\u8b77\u3001\u30c7\u30fc\u30bf\u4fdd\u8b77\u3001\u30a4\u30f3\u30b7\u30c7\u30f3\u30c8\u306e\u5bfe\u5fdc)\u306e\u5177\u4f53\u7684\u306a\u5b9f\u8df5\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n\n
\nID\u30d7\u30ed\u30d0\u30a4\u30c0\u30fc\u3068\u7d71\u5408\u3057\u305f\u8a8d\u8a3c\u30fb\u627f\u8a8d\u30e1\u30ab\u30cb\u30ba\u30e0\u306e\u4f7f\u7528\u306a\u3069\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n<\/li>\n
\n\u30a2\u30af\u30bb\u30b9\u6bce\u306e\u52d5\u7684\u8a8d\u8a3c\u306b\u3088\u308b\u4e00\u6642\u7684\u306a\u8a8d\u8a3c\u60c5\u5831\u306e\u4f7f\u7528\u306a\u3069\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n<\/li>\n
\n\u30a2\u30d7\u30ea\u30b1\u30fc\u30b7\u30e7\u30f3\u30b3\u30fc\u30c9\u30ec\u30d9\u30eb\u3067\u306e\u30bb\u30ad\u30e5\u30ea\u30c6\u30a3\u30d7\u30e9\u30af\u30c6\u30a3\u30b9\u306e\u30ec\u30d3\u30e5\u30fc\u3068\u81ea\u52d5\u5316\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002\u30b7\u30d5\u30c8\u30ec\u30d5\u30c8\u306e\u8003\u3048\u65b9\u306e\u5b9f\u8df5\u306b\u306a\u308a\u307e\u3059\u3002<\/p>\n<\/li>\n<\/ul>\nREL(\u4fe1\u983c\u6027\u306e\u67f1)<\/h3>\n
\n
\n\u30b9\u30ed\u30c3\u30c8\u30ea\u30f3\u30b0\u3092\u6d3b\u7528\u3057\u305f\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u306e\u5b9a\u5e38\u72b6\u614b\u306e\u7dad\u6301\u306a\u3069\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002\u307e\u305f\u3001\u30ef\u30fc\u30af\u30ed\u30fc\u30c9\u306e\u5bfe\u5fdc\u529b\u3092\u6e2c\u308b\u305f\u3081\u306b\u7d99\u7d9a\u7684\u306a\u8ca0\u8377\u30c6\u30b9\u30c8\u306e\u5b9f\u65bd\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n<\/li>\n
\n\u4f8b\u3048\u3070\u30c7\u30c3\u30c9\u30ec\u30bf\u30fc\u30ad\u30e5\u30fc\u306e\u4ed5\u7d44\u307f\u306b\u3088\u308b\u5931\u6557\u3057\u305f\u51e6\u7406\u306e\u4fdd\u6301\/\u8abf\u67fb\/\u518d\u8a66\u884c\u306a\u3069\u3001\u969c\u5bb3\u304b\u3089\u306e\u7d20\u65e9\u3044\u5fa9\u65e7\u3084\u30d5\u30a9\u30fc\u30eb\u30c8\u30c8\u30ec\u30e9\u30f3\u30c8\u306a\u4ed5\u7d44\u307f\u304c\u6c42\u3081\u3089\u308c\u3066\u3044\u307e\u3059\u3002<\/p>\n<\/li>\n<\/ul>\nPERF(\u30d1\u30d5\u30a9\u30fc\u30de\u30f3\u30b9\u52b9\u7387\u306e\u67f1)<\/h3>\n